Prime Minister Justin Trudeau's call for an immediate ceasefire amid escalating violence in the Middle East highlights the increasing civilian toll, which he attributes to a cycle of retaliation involving Hamas, Hezbollah, and Israel. His stance echoes a sentiment echoed by thousands in several major cities as pro-Palestinian demonstrators took to the streets advocating for peace and highlighting the urgent need for diplomacy.

The ongoing situation has exacerbated humanitarian crises, with reports detailing the tragic loss of life following airstrikes in Lebanon, including notable casualties reported due to the bombardments and ensuing chaos. The conflict's intensity has reached a point where discussions of military readiness, such as Iran’s recent missile strike threats against Israel, add further layers of tension and complicate diplomatic efforts.

Back in Canada, Trudeau's participation in discussions on artificial intelligence during the Francophonie summit reflects a growing recognition of technology's role in shaping future global discourse.
